Application
Analytes included: GCP2, HCC-1, I-TAC, IL-11, IL-29, Lymphotactin, M-CSF, MIG, MIP-3α, MIP-3α, NAP2
Note: HCC-1/CCL14a and NAP-2/CXCL7 cannot be plexed with other analytes for serum/plasma.

"Multiplex detection is a highly efficient tool for measuring the levels of multiple analytes in a single sample. MILLIPLEX® MAP assay panels provide a complete solution for multiplex detection of analytes within particular research areas using the bead-based Luminex® xMAP® technology. Previously, the only option for analyzing MILLIPLEX® MAP assays required the Luminex 200™ or FLEXMAP 3D® analyzers. With the launch of the MAGPIX® system, MILLIPLEX® MAP magnetic bead assays can be analyzed without the use of lasers or hydrodynamic focusing. The MAGPIX® instrument is a compact, cost-effective multiplexing system based on CCD imaging technology. The MAGPIX® instrument was specifically designed to yield comparable results to the Luminex 200™ instrument. To demonstrate similarity between the two systems, we ran parallel assays using the MILLIPLEX® MAP Human Cytokine/Chemokine Magnetic Bead Panel. Standard curve median fluorescence intensity (MFI) and sample range data are similar between the two instrument systems. Furthermore, sample concentration data between the MAGPIX® and Luminex 200™ systems demonstrate correlation coefficients ≥ 0.97."
